WebApr 22, 2010 · 106. Apr 22, 2010. #7. Re: Painting Clearcoat over Gelcoat. Bubba1235 said: You don't say what year this boat is but I suspect the problem has been caused by UV exposure. (As opposed to oxidation.) With UV the issue is that the Gel Coat breaks down fairly deep and you have to remove (sand) it down to solid Gel Coat. Incorrect Surface Preparation – Gelcoat will only adhere to fiberglass, previously cured gelcoat, or polyester resin. Do not apply gelcoat to any paint or protective coating because it will not adhere. Existing paint will have to be removed. In order to prepare the surface correctly, it must be sanded. github fcnWebMay 1, 2024 · At temperatures below 60 degrees F and above 80 degrees F, never apply gelcoat. Allow ventilation to occur.
